1. Vaibhav Suryavanshi (India)
Vaibhav Suryavanshi, who is only 14 years of age, has shocked the cricket fraternity with his incredible performance during the 2025 IPL league. The teenage sensation hit his century off just 35 balls, becoming the youngest player to do so in the history of the league. This makes him one of the most talked-about young cricketers in 2025.
Why He’s a Star:
- Lightning-fast reflexes
- Excellent hand-eye coordination
- Calm under pressure
His batting technique and aggressive mindset mirror that of a young Virat Kohli. Experts believe Vaibhav could be the face of Indian cricket in the next decade.

3. Ubaid Shah (Pakistan)
The younger sibling of Pakistani bowler sensation Naseem Shah, Ubaid is already bowling at velocities that are at par with senior professionals. Now at the age of 19, he has become an established name in Pakistan’s domestic and U-19 team.
Attributes:
- Express pace (145+ km/h)
- Lethal yorkers and bouncers
- Strong work ethic
Many cricket experts believe he could be Pakistan’s next major fast bowling sensation. With the right guidance, he could soon dominate on the international stage.
4. Noor Ahmad (Afghanistan)
Noor Ahmad is a young left-arm wrist spinner who has already played in various T20 leagues, including the IPL and BBL. At 20, he has the experience of a seasoned professional and the hunger of a newcomer.
Why He’s Promising:
- Deceptive variations
- Excellent control over line and length
- Regular wicket-taker
His mystery spin and ability to deliver in high-pressure situations make him a valuable asset across all formats.
5. Tom Prest (England)
Tom Prest is an upcoming English batsman who led the U-19 side and is now creating ripples in county cricket. With his charismatic batting and leadership potential, Prest is poised to shoulder future global duties.
Key Highlights:
- Classic English technique
- Consistent run-scorer in domestic cricket
- Strong leadership capabilities
He’s often compared to Joe Root and has already been included in the England Lions squads, a clear indicator of his potential.
